Output caee233609afbb7deadb16d88c29cfd63c4f9b96a951c9db331004e02f424a03:2

value
39782602
script pubkey
OP_0 OP_PUSHBYTES_20 835a18c76b456a30969048937f62e37d0482b3a1
address
bc1qsddp33mtg44rp95sfzfh7chr05zg9vapa84xe0
transaction
caee233609afbb7deadb16d88c29cfd63c4f9b96a951c9db331004e02f424a03
spent
true